According to the DC motor's equation:
Terminal voltage: V = LδI/δt + Ia*Ra + kb*ω
and to a first order approximation Torque: τ = kt*I
and you solve for speed as a function of torque, keeping the terminal voltage constant, you will find that changes in the load torque will cause a very significant change in the motor speed, and depending on the moment of inertia, the system could even become unstable.
